Publication number: 20220183528Abstract: A cleaning method of a cleaning robot includes, when the cleaning robot travels along an obstacle, driving a rear end of the cleaning robot, on which a cleaning member is arranged, to make multiple turning motions towards the obstacle and multiple backswings away from the obstacle, thereby cleaning a blind zone of the cleaning robot relative to the obstacle. In such a way, blind zones are cleaned when cleaning along obstacles.Type: ApplicationFiled: December 8, 2021Publication date: June 16, 2022Applicant: Yunjing Intelligence (Shenzhen) Co., Ltd.Inventor: Junbin Zhang

Publication number: 20220001511Abstract: The present invention relates to a method of treating a surface of a utensil as well as to a utensil having been treated by the method. A substrate is provided to form a component of the utensil. The substrate has a surface area to be treated. Through a shot peening process particles impact the substrate substantially evenly across the surface area, so as to dimple the substrate with depressions across the surface area, in order to reduce adhesion of matter on the treated surface area of the utensil.Type: ApplicationFiled: September 22, 2021Publication date: January 6, 2022Inventors: Zhihui FENG, Junbin ZHANG

Publication number: 20210177227Abstract: Disclosed relates to a mopping member, a mopping apparatus, a cleaning robot, and a control method for the cleaning robot. The mopping member includes a first mop and a second mop; the first mop is provided with a first rotating center, the second mop is provided with a second rotating center, and the distance between the first rotating center and the second rotating center is a rotating center distance. When the first mop and the second mop rotate, a short-diameter edge of one mop corresponds to a long-diameter edge of the other mop; at a connection line position of the first rotating center and the second rotating center, a gap between the first mop and the second mop is formed between the short-diameter edge of one mop and the corresponding long-diameter edge of the other mop.Type: ApplicationFiled: February 26, 2021Publication date: June 17, 2021Applicant: Yunjing Intelligence Technology (Dongguan) Co., Ltd.Inventors: Junbin ZHANG, Weijin LIN
